Course Content

• EV Charging Infrastructure Design and Planning
• Battery Energy Storage Systems (BESS) for EV Charging
• Power Electronics for EV Charging and Grid Integration
• Advanced Control Strategies for EV Charging Stations
• Smart Grid Technologies and EV Charging Management
• Electrical Safety and Regulations in EV Charging Deployments
• Renewable Energy Integration with EV Charging
• Data Analytics and Demand-Side Management in EV Charging

Career path

Career Role Description
EV Charging Infrastructure Engineer (EV Charging, Energy Storage) Design, install, and maintain EV charging stations and associated energy storage systems. High demand due to rapid EV adoption.
Energy Storage System Specialist (Energy Storage, Battery Technology) Focuses on the energy storage aspect of EV charging infrastructure, ensuring optimal performance and lifespan of battery systems. A crucial role in grid stability.
EV Charging Network Manager (EV Charging, Network Management) Manages the operational aspects of large-scale EV charging networks, optimizing performance and user experience. Requires strong data analysis skills.
Renewable Energy Integration Specialist (Renewable Energy, Energy Storage) Integrates renewable energy sources (solar, wind) with EV charging infrastructure and energy storage solutions, promoting sustainable practices. A growing field with high future potential.

Why this course?

An Advanced Certificate in EV Charging Energy Storage is increasingly significant in the UK's rapidly expanding electric vehicle (EV) sector. The UK government aims for all new car sales to be zero-emission by 2030, driving substantial growth in EV charging infrastructure. This necessitates skilled professionals proficient in EV charging energy storage systems. According to recent data, the number of public EV charge points in the UK has increased by 46% in the last year, highlighting the growing demand for expertise in this area. This surge in demand for charging infrastructure presents ample opportunities for those with the right qualifications.

Year Public Charge Points (thousands)
2022 30
2023 44
